Why the fleet comes here
- Formentera
- Sandbanks and seagrass, and the day everyone in Ibiza spends there
- Ibiza Town
- Marina Ibiza and Marina Botafoch under the walls of Dalt Vila
- Es Vedrà
- The rock off the south-west coast, and the reason the sunset anchorages face where they do
- S’Espalmador
- The private islet between Ibiza and Formentera, anchored off in settled weather
- Cala Comte
- The sunset anchorage on the west coast, looking at Es Vedrà
- Cala Bassa
- A beach club and a crowded day anchorage on the west coast
- Ses Illetes
- The sandspit at the north end of Formentera, and the anchorage either side of it
- Cala Jondal
- The south-coast beach clubs, tendered to from the anchorage
